WebThe occipital lobe is located at the back of the brain and is primarily involved in processing visual information. It includes the primary visual cortex, which processes basic visual features such as color, orientation, and motion, and the association cortex, which integrates visual information with other sensory modalities and higher cognitive ... dakine hot laps 2l fanny pack
